Michael Wilbon writes for The Washington Post, hosts "Pardon the Interruption" on ESPN, and provides halftime commentary on the NBA for ABC, so he's obviously a busy guy. Like most of us, he picked the Lakers to win the Finals, and now that they're down 3-1 and on the verge of losing the series, he sees a number of reasons why we were all so wrong to pick against Boston.
"The vast majority of us should be ashamed for being so blinded by the glare of the Lakers because it was all right there in front of us even before the championship series began. The Celtics aren't just better than the Lakers; they're superior..."
